Despite the harsh limits on ladies’s freedoms and rights in ancient Greece, their rights in context of divorce had been fairly liberal. Marriage might be terminated by mutual consent or action taken by both spouse. If a woman needed to terminate her marriage, she needed the help of her father or different male relative to represent her, as a result of as a woman she was not considered a citizen of Greece. If a person wished a divorce nonetheless, all he needed to do was throw his spouse out of his house. In the occasion of a divorce, the dowry was returned to the lady’s guardian and she had the right to retain ½ of the goods she had produced whereas within the marriage. If the couple had kids, divorce resulted in paternal full custody, as youngsters are seen as belonging to his household.

While males in marriages had free reign to commit adultery, the wives were expected to stay loyal to their husbands. In addition, they had been expected to supply sons to preserve the male line. Marriage was mainly the only goal for women in ancient Greece because there was no role or respect for unmarried mature ladies.
